Electric motor cuts energy use by 20 percent

Los Angeles reports engineer Cravens Vanlass claims a controlled torque motor uses 20 percent less current than conventional motors of the same horsepower. Southern California Edison tested hundreds and confirmed savings, with authorities estimating potential oil savings of up to two million barrels daily and noting broad energy crisis implications.

Record U S Trade Gap Grows in March as Imports Surge

The Commerce Department said U S imports topped 12 billion for the first time in March due to sharply higher petroleum purchases, pushing the monthly trade deficit to a new record of 2.4 billion. First quarter 1977 deficit reached 5.9 billion, versus 5.87 billion in all of 1976. Exports were 10.7 billion, the highest since 10.4 billion.

Tax bill faces Senate test amid push for permanent cuts

President Carter's stimulus plan and a GOP proposal for permanent tax cuts head to a Senate vote. The Republican plan would trim rates 5 to 14 percent on the first 20000 of income and alter the standard deduction, affecting millions including families earning under 20 000 and those around 30 000.

Jobs bill advances as Congress endorses first part of Carter plan

A Senate House conference committee approved a $4 billion jobs bill to fund local public works including bridges sewers and hospitals, expected to create 150000 to 400000 jobs. Congress also debates separate public service youth training tax cuts and revenue sharing while steering toward a permanent tax reduction.

Fatigued crew halts North Sea well cap Effort

A seven man crew led by two Texans halted capping the Bravo rig in the Ekofisk field due to workload and safety concerns after nearing activation of blind rams. Phillips Petroleum expects to resume work Thursday as the 36,000 gallon per hour gusher continues and oil slick expands toward 150 square miles.

Tax collectors to discuss penalty in Arkansas meeting

Arkansas tax collectors plan a meeting in Little Rock to decide on applying a 10 percent penalty to late tax payments. Atty. Gen. Bill Clinton issued an opinion stating the penalty is required when taxes due in four installments are not paid by October 10.

Bribe offer cited in Tennessee governor office probe

An aide to Governor Blanton offered a bribe to Bell, a secretary of state extradition official, reports reveal. FBI tape records and several raids tied to the extradition case surface as the Sisk, pardon, and parole offices draw scrutiny. The probe coincides with a Senate panel's move to expand the pardon and parole board and restructure its powers.
